Mouse Periostin / POSTN Protein (His Tag)

Sino Biological

DESCRIPTION

A DNA sequence encoding the full length of mouse POSTN (NP_056599.1) (Met 1-Gln 811) was expressed, with a polyhistidine tag at the C-terminus.

DETAILS

  • Tag: C-His
  • Purity: > 92 % as determined by SDS-PAGE
  • Source: HEK293 Cells
  • Species: Mouse
  • Storage: Store it under sterile conditions at -20℃ to -80℃. It is recommended that the protein be aliquoted for optimal storage.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
  • Activity: Measured by its ability to induce adhesion of ATDC5 mouse chondrogenic cells. When cells are added to POSTN-His coated plates (10 μg/mL, 100 μL/well), approximately >40% will adhere specifically after 30 minutes at 37℃.
  • Molecule: POSTN
  • Endotoxin: < 1.0 EU per μg of the protein as determined by the LAL method
  • Lead Time: 1-3 days
  • Formulation: Lyophilized from sterile PBS, pH 7.4
  • Molecular Mass: The secreted recombinant mouse POSTN consists of 799 amino acids and has a calculated molecular mass of 89 kDa. The apparent molecular mass of rmPOSTN is approximately 80-85 kDa in S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ions.
  • Reconstitution: A hardcopy of datasheet with reconstitution instructions is sent along with the products. Please refer to it for detailed information.
  • Accession Number: NP_056599.1
  • Predicted N Terminal: Asn 24
